Tradeweb Markets Total Long-Term Assets 2018-2026 | TW

Tradeweb Markets total long-term assets from 2018 to 2026. Total long-term assets can be defined as the sum of all assets classified as non-current
  • Tradeweb Markets total long-term assets for the quarter ending March 31, 2026 were $5.818B, a 4.77% increase year-over-year.
  • Tradeweb Markets total long-term assets for 2025 were $5.779B, a 3.53% increase from 2024.
  • Tradeweb Markets total long-term assets for 2024 were $5.582B, a 17.13% increase from 2023.
  • Tradeweb Markets total long-term assets for 2023 were $4.766B, a 1.2% decline from 2022.

Tradeweb Markets Inc. is an operator of electronic marketplaces for the trading of products across the rates, credit, money markets and equities asset classes. The Company provides access to markets, data and analytics, electronic trading, straight-through-processing and reporting to clients in the institutional, wholesale and retail markets. Tradeweb Markets Inc. is based in New York, United States.
